简介
@sudoku-generator 是一个 npm 包,是专门为大家提供 Sudoku(数独游戏)的生成 API。该包的作者是 jlguenego。
在这篇文章里,我们会介绍如何使用 @jlguenego/sudoku-generator,包括其方法、参数以及一些示例代码。
安装
@jlguenego/sudoku-generator 可以通过 npm 来进行安装。您需要在终端内执行以下命令:
npm i @jlguenego/sudoku-generator
安装成功后,您可以通过以下代码引用它:
const sudoku = require("@jlguenego/sudoku-generator");
API
@sudoku-generator 提供了以下方法,可供开发者使用:
sudoku.generatePuzzle(difficulty: string): string[]
使用该方法可以生成数独游戏(所选难度)的终局和开局。
该方法只有一个参数 difficulty
,用于指定数独游戏的难度。可选值为 "easy"、"medium" 和 "hard",默认值为 "medium"。
该方法的返回值为一个数组,第一个元素为数独游戏的终局,第二个元素为数独游戏的开局。
以下为示例代码:
-- -------------------- ---- ------- ----- ------ - --------------------------------------- ----- ---------- ------- - ------------------------------ ---------------------- --- ---------------------- -------------------- --- --------------------
示例代码
以下是一些使用 @jlguenego/sudoku-generator 的示例代码:
-- -------------------- ---- ------- ----- ------ - --------------------------------------- ----- ---------- ------- - -------------------------------- -- -------- ---------------------- --- ---------------------- -------------------- --- -------------------- -- ----- ----- ----------- -------- - ------------------------------ ----- ----------- -------- - ------------------------------ ------------------ --- --------------------- ------------------ --- ---------------------
结论
@sudoku-generator 包提供了生成数独游戏的 API,帮助您快速便捷地生成一个数独游戏。本文已经介绍了 @jlguenego/sudoku-generator 包的安装方法、API 使用方法以及示例代码。如果您正在开发一个数字游戏或是有其他相关的需求,那么这个包就是您不可错过的利器。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60065b46c6eb7e50355dbf15